Introduction

The Institute of Banking Personnel Selection (IBPS) conducts the Regional Rural Bank (RRB) Clerk examination to recruit candidates for clerical positions in regional rural banks across India. As the exam date approaches, it’s crucial to have a well-structured study plan to maximize your preparation and increase your chances of success. In this blog, we present a comprehensive 30-day study plan to help you excel in the IBPS RRB Clerk examination.

Day 1-5: Familiarize Yourself with the Exam Pattern and Syllabus

  • Begin by understanding the exam pattern and syllabus thoroughly.
  • Analyze previous years’ question papers to identify important topics and question patterns.
  • Make a list of topics that require more attention and create a schedule accordingly.

Day 6-10: Strengthen Your Numerical Ability

  • Focus on strengthening your mathematical skills, including topics like simplification, number series, data interpretation, and arithmetic.
  • Practice a variety of questions from each topic to improve your speed and accuracy.
  • Refer to standard books and online resources for concept clarification.

Day 11-15: Enhance Your Reasoning Ability

  • Dedicate these days to enhancing your reasoning ability, as it carries significant weightage in the IBPS RRB Clerk exam.
  • Cover topics such as coding-decoding, blood relations, syllogism, puzzles, and seating arrangement.
  • Solve a wide range of reasoning questions, including both verbal and non-verbal reasoning.

Sign Up & Take a Free Full-Lenght Test Now!!

Day 16-20: Master Your English Language Skills

  • Focus on improving your vocabulary, grammar, comprehension, and sentence formation.
  • Read newspapers, articles, and magazines to enhance your reading comprehension skills.
  • Practice exercises and quizzes to improve your grasp of English language rules and usage.

Day 21-25: Boost Your General Awareness

  • Allocate these days to enhance your general awareness and current affairs knowledge.
  • Stay updated with national and international news, economic trends, sports, and important events.
  • Refer to newspapers, magazines, and online resources for daily news updates.

Additional Tips:

  1. Maintain a consistent study schedule and avoid procrastination.
  2. Take short breaks between study sessions to rejuvenate your mind.
  3. Stay healthy by eating nutritious food, exercising regularly, and getting enough sleep.
  4. Join online forums or study groups to discuss and clarify doubts with fellow aspirants.
  5. Stay positive and believe in yourself. Confidence is key to success.
